A nurse came with the papers. Jeremy signed them quickly.

"Start the operation to save her life immediately!" He ordered the nurse in such a scary voice, she ran back where she came from quickly.

Jeremy was pacing around the place nervously Elsa got prepared for surgery.

And when it was time, he watched them carry her in a stretcher bed taking her from the room she was in, and to the operation room.

His heart was beating fast. He was shaking while sweating at the same time.

The three people in the hallway were nervously pacing around or tapping their foot an hour after Elsa's surgery began.

They were outside the operating room waiting for the doctors to come out of there with some good news, they hoped.

The hours turned to three, and they were still waiting.

Jeremy had taken off his coat and tie and thrown them somewhere as his anxiety took hold.

He didn't understand what was going on with him. He shouldn't care what happens to Elsa. He shouldn't at all.

Jeremy saw Hayley seated on the bench by herself, away from him and Bruno.

He went over to her and sat next to her.

Hayley had lowered her head crying before. But now, she turned to Jeremy with cold eyes, "What do you want now, you scumbag?"

Jeremy saw her hostility for him and was about to explain himself only for his phone to ring with a notification.

His assistant had sent him a video.

He clicked on it with trembling hands.

And there it was.

A girl who looked like Elsa was standing on the side of the road talking to her phone. The moment a car stopped close to her, she smiled and hung up the call.

And as she did, the driver's side of the car was opened and another girl who looked like Elsa got off and ran to hug the other girl who looked like her!

There was a figure still inside the car who seemed to be Hayley.

The two identical girls hugged each other tightly for some good seconds before the one who drove helped the other put her luggage into the car boot.

Jeremy couldn't believe his eyes.

Before he could process anything, his phone rang. His assistant was calling.

"I have to tell you Mr. Callahan, the video I just sent you had been lost for some reason, in the storage files. I was told that the cameras had some difficulties at that exact time so they didn't record anything. But I knew something was wrong. Good thing it wasn't hard for me to recover them. I just called an expert and we went to the storage system and found that this clip had been removed. So, he recovered it for me."

All the life drained from Jeremy's arms as he lowered the phone from his ear.

'Elsa.... Elsa is not Gwen!... oh my god she was telling me the truth!'

'She was.... she was also... she was also the girl I saw at Serpens University.... it was her... but I mistook her for Gwen....'

'Then I mistook Gwen for her.... and then I... and then I.... oh god what have I done!'

Hayley overheard that conversation. She chuckled bitterly as she looked at Jeremy. "See how it was that simple for you to find out the truth? For you to prevent all of this from happening? It was just one phone call away. That simple, Jeremy Callahan. It was that easy for you not to be lied to, that easy.

"How do you feel now? Mmh? How does it feel knowing you were wrong this whole time?"

Jeremy abruptly got up from the bench. "I have to apologize to her!... I have to apologize to Elsa!... I have to tell her I'm sorry!" There was panic, and fear in his voice.

He rushed over to the door. Forgetting himself, he tried to open it.

His phone had been tossed away somewhere, he didn't even know where.

If not for the fact that the door was locked from the inside, Jeremy would have budged in.

"Jeremy what are you doing? Are you trying to interrupt the surgery? Do you want to kill Elsa?!" Hayley shouted as she pushed Jeremy away from the door.

Brain surgery was a delicate operation. The doctors needed to be fully concerntrated. One wrong move could bring serious consequences. Just like heart surgery.

Jeremy backed away from the door as his eyes got even more red. He only stopped when he hit the wall.

"No.... I don't... want to interrupt... I want to say... I want to say that I'm sorry." His voice sounded so heavy and shaky.

He slid down the wall until he sat on the floor.

He ran his fingers through his hair as stared at the operation room door.

"Elsa..." He called out with a broken voice.
